Top Stocks Making Headlines After Hours

In the latest after hours trading session, key stocks such as Affirm, Pinterest, and Trade Desk drew considerable attention. Affirm’s decline by 9% signals a cautionary note for investors, as its revenue guidance fell short of expectations. On the other hand, Pinterest’s stock surged over 15% following positive earnings news, showing how well it navigated its business outlook, aligning with current trends in social media and digital marketing.

Trade Desk also made headlines with a significant increase of nearly 13%, reflecting a robust performance that outperformed forecasts. These movements highlight the volatility present in after hours trading and the importance of staying updated with stock market news. Investors should pay close attention to such shifts as they can often provide insights into market trends and potential pre-market movers that could set the tone for the following trading day.

Coinbase’s performance faced scrutiny with a disappointing first-quarter revenue report leading to a 3% drop in its stock price. This minor decline is a reminder of how sensitive high-profile stocks are to market expectations and earnings surprises. Meanwhile, companies like Microchip Technology, which saw a 7% rise in its stock price due to favorable earnings guidance, show the potential upside that can accompany a well-executed business strategy. Tips for Trading in After Hours Markets

Trading in after hours markets can be a strategic advantage for savvy investors, providing unique opportunities to act on news and financial results released outside typical trading hours. To navigate this environment successfully, it’s important to stay updated on market movements and remain vigilant about earnings announcements or guidance changes, as they can significantly impact stock prices.

Additionally, understanding the liquidity and spread can help mitigate risks associated with after hours trading. Since fewer participants are trading, stocks may experience wider price fluctuations. Employing a careful strategy that considers current market conditions and leveraging resources such as stock market news can enhance the chances for successful trades in after hours.

Can I trade top stocks during after hours and are there risks involved?

Yes, you can trade top stocks during after hours, but there are inherent risks involved, such as lower liquidity and higher volatility. Prices can fluctuate significantly with fewer participants in the market, which may result in larger spreads between bid and ask prices. Investors should be cautious and consider these factors when participating in after hours trading.

Company Stock Movement Reason for Movement
Affirm -9% Lower revenue guidance for Q4, below consensus.
Pinterest +15% Exceeded Q1 revenue expectations and provided strong Q2 guidance.
Coinbase -3% Disappointing Q1 revenue figures compared to expected results.
Sweetgreen -8% Lowered full-year earnings outlook, missing analyst expectations.
Trade Desk +13% Better-than-expected Q1 results, surpassing revenue forecasts.
Microchip Technology +7% Higher-than-expected Q1 guidance boosts investor confidence.
Monster Beverage -2% Q1 revenue fell short of analyst expectations.
